Cost of senior care in Huntersville, NC
Assisted living in Huntersville, NC has a median cost of $6,496 per month. Non-medical in-home care runs about $30 per hour (NC median, CareScout 2025), or roughly $4,800 per month for full-time help.
| Care type | Typical cost |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Non-medical in-home care | $30/hour | ~$4,800/mo full-time |
| Assisted living | $6,496/month | private one-bedroom |
| Nursing home | $10,798/month | ~$129,576/yr, private room |
Source: CareScout Cost of Care Survey (2025).

Does Medicaid help pay for senior care in NC?
Yes. NC's Medicaid program offers waivers that can help cover home care and, in some cases, assisted living for residents who meet income and care-need rules. Eligibility and covered services vary, so confirm the details with the state program.
